The "Prelude", also known as the "Crystal Theme", is a recurring piece of music that appears in most Final Fantasy games. The music of the video game Final Fantasy X was composed by regular series composer Nobuo Uematsu, along with Masashi Hamauzu and Junya Nakano.It was the first title in the main Final Fantasy series in which Uematsu was not the sole composer. Final Fantasy XII (2006) was composed by Hitoshi Sakimoto, with six other compositions by Hayato Matsuo and Masaharu Iwata. Final Fantasy is a science fiction and fantasy media franchise created by Hironobu Sakaguchi, and developed and owned by Square Enix (formerly Square).
